Jain: The prevailing inefficient irrigation practices in India account for significant energy consumption, with a substantial quantity of water going waste in the form of evapotranspiration, surface run off and percolation, without contributing to any yield increase. Drip irrigation methods demonstrate 70-90% water use efficiency, while conventional flood irrigation has field level application efficiency of only 40-50%. Drip irrigation also saves on the electricity used for pumping ground water, and improves the yield from 30-200% for various crops. ... "
" ... Made with galvanized steel, the recyclable, light open structures multiply activities adapted to user needs. They use a system of passive air-conditioning based on chilling by evapotranspiration, often used in greenhouses, an example of the use of off-the-shelf products and technologies to guarantee efficiency and low cost. On the tops of the air trees, directional wind catchers introduce air into the towers, with the help of fans. The dry air passes through water atomizers, becomes moist and drops to create a microclimate, thereby reducing the temperature, particularly efficient in areas of high temperatures and low relative humidity. " ... Only 6% of cropland in Brazil is irrigated and rely mostly on the regions rainfall as a water source. With fewer trees due to the land-clearing, there is less evapotranspiration — how much water is recycled back into the atmosphere — which decreases water recycled back into the atmosphere and can lead to less rainfall. ... " ... The “ET” in OpenET stands for evapotranspiration, which is the process by which water is returned to the atmosphere through evaporation off the land surface and transpiration from plants. It can be thought of as essentially the opposite of precipitation. For farmers and water managers, ET is a key measure of water consumed by crops and vegetation, and can also be used to better understand how much water a crop actually uses to grow. ... "
